I have a 01 focus with the stock stereo. I am wondering what is the COMP and AVC found on the MENU??? What do they do or what are they for??? Why the AVC has a +5 power or whatever it is?
1 - 4 of 4 Posts
AVC = Automatic Volume Control

- As the car goes faster, the radio gets louder. As the car goes slower, the radio gets quieter. It "keeps" whatever perceived volume you want. It works most of the times...but some have found it to be buggy.

COMP = Compile (I think)

- It's like a sound compiler that helps even out songs...mainly for burned CD's I've found. Sometimes, the tracks you burn onto a CD might be louder/quieter than the track next to it. So, it helps to "even out" the songs.

Close. COMP means Compander, or Compressor/Expander and its function is like you say. It amplifies (expands) quiet parts of the song and quiets (compresses) loud parts.
